Land excavation services involve the careful removal, movement, and grading of soil, rocks, and other earth materials on a property. This process typically requires specialized equipment to dig trenches, level land, or clear areas for construction or landscaping projects. Whether preparing a site for a new foundation, installing a driveway, or creating a level yard, excavation ensures the ground is properly shaped and stable for the next phase of development. Experienced contractors can handle a variety of excavation tasks to meet the specific needs of each property.

These services help solve common problems such as uneven terrain, poor drainage, or unsuitable soil conditions. For homeowners planning to build a new structure or improve their outdoor space, proper excavation can prevent future issues like flooding or foundation settling. It also addresses problems related to landscaping, such as creating terraces or installing retaining walls. By working with local contractors, property owners can ensure that the land is prepared correctly, reducing the risk of costly repairs or delays down the line.

Properties that often require excavation services include residential homes, especially those undergoing renovations or new construction projects. Larger residential lots may need grading to improve water runoff or to create level areas for lawns, patios, or pools. Commercial properties, including retail developments or office parks, also frequently utilize excavation to prepare the land for building foundations, parking lots, or landscaping features. Even properties with existing structures might need excavation for drainage upgrades or underground utilities installation.

The overview below groups typical Land Excavation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Benton County, IN.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Residential Projects - typical costs range from $250 to $600 for routine land excavation jobs such as yard leveling or small garden trenches. Many local contractors handle these projects within this middle range, though prices can vary based on site conditions.

Medium-Scale Excavations - projects like driveway prep or foundation digging usually cost between $1,000 and $3,000. These are common for residential properties and tend to fall within this range, with fewer jobs reaching higher prices.

Larger Commercial or Complex Projects - extensive land clearing or site preparation for new developments can range from $3,500 to $10,000 or more. Such jobs are less frequent and often involve additional equipment or permits, pushing costs into higher tiers.

Full Land Replacement or Major Excavation - large-scale projects, including complete site overhaul or significant grading, can exceed $10,000 and reach $20,000+ depending on scope. These are less common and typically involve detailed planning and specialized equipment.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
